## Releases

Grantnote receipt mailer ships weekly, Thursdays. Cut from main, tag, run the receipt-render suite, check the thank-you template against last quarter's donor tiers. No hotfixes outside the window without sign-off at sync. Builds go to the mail relay only after signing. Current release signing key is below.

release key, fahaf-bajof: bky3_Xam

Ticket #2310 — Vault sealed, crash-report pipeline stalled

The Crestfall vault storing signing keys for the Pebblewing mobile crash-report pipeline sealed itself after a node restart. Symbolication jobs are queuing and on-call should unseal it before the backlog exceeds retention. Standard unseal via the pipeline admin console; enter the recovery passphrase shown below.

unlock words, hahip-baduf: holwyn-istath-julvan

## Local Setup — Waveform Preview

Hey future maintainer! The waveform preview in Chirpdeck renders clips client-side, but it still needs the sample cache warmed up locally. Run `make seed-audio` first, otherwise you'll stare at empty gray bars and question your life choices. The preview service expects Postgres 15-ish; older versions choke on the range types we use for clip regions. Once the seed finishes, the app boots on port 4810. Point the preview worker at the metadata database using the connection string below.

primary connection of tawif-yajeg = postgresql://rusiel_svc:G879q9cx6GsSvj@db-dd9f.norvagrid.internal:5432/casath

## Deploying the Gatewick Proctor Queue

Deploys are pretty painless: push to main, wait for the pipeline, then watch the queue drain dashboard for five minutes. If candidates pile up mid-exam, roll back first and ask questions later — the queue replays safely. Everything the workers care about lives in one config block, shown here for reference.

settings of bafof-yagef:
JOROX_PIN=8740
JOROX_TENANT=pelox
JOROX_METRICS_HOST=metrics.jorox.qorvelworks.internal
JOROX_SEAL=seal_c78f63c1
JOROX_STANDBY_TEAM=norax